gz839918 wrote: December 7th, 2019, 5:29 pm
eagerlearner102 wrote: December 6th, 2019, 8:42 pm How do you guys memorize everything from genetics? I read a genetics textbook and I forgot most of what I read.
Take notes. In addition to the 8.5 in×11 in sheet of the notes that you get, make a separate notebook filled with just your general notes. This will let you review the material later on.

Moreover, since you're doing this for SciOly and not a class, remember that it's completely okay if you want to slow down and muse over the ideas in your head. Meaningful is memorable. If something really surprises you ("whoa! I didn't know a gene could parasitize other genes in the same person!"), think about writing it down in a way that you could explain the topic to a friend. If something doesn't make sense, jot down a reminder to look it up later. The thing is, if a topic doesn't mean much to you when reading, it won't mean much to you at a competition. So, the more time you spend thinking about the meaning of the content, the more readily it will remain in your mind.

One final thing I'll say is that I see you're around a lot on the forums. If you love doing SciOly, why not write a test for designer genes? It'll help jog your memory; you'll know what test writers are looking for by doing it yourself; and plus, if you make test questions about topics in genetics you're truly interested in, you can share your love for genetics vicariously through everybody who takes your test :)
